Full Job Description
Overview

Company Name: IndeVets

Industry: Veterinary Staffing

Location: Philadelphia, PA preferred (Hybrid); Remote candidates considered

Responsibilities

The VP of Marketing & Growth will lead IndeVets marketing and growth strategy across veterinarian acquisition, brand, and hospital demand generation, with a clear focus on accelerating veterinarian acquisition while building awareness and demand across both sides of the marketplace. Reporting to the COO, your primary mandate will be to build a scalable, measurable engine for veterinarian growth, increasing the number of veterinarians who discover IndeVets, engage with our brand, enter the recruiting funnel, and ultimately become Associate IndeVets (AIV). This role owns brand, growth marketing, recruiting marketing, hospital marketing, content, communications, and marketing operations while partnering closely with Recruiting, Sales, and Account Management to capitalize on growth opportunities.
  • Accelerate AIV Growth
  • Own the strategy for increasing the number of new veterinarians joining IndeVets, identifying and attacking the highest-impact opportunities across the full acquisition funnel.
  • Build and optimize growth across paid, organic, referral, partnership, lifecycle, and other channels, partnering cross-functionally to improve conversion and remove barriers to growth.
  • Build a World-Class Growth Engine
  • Build the growth model, scorecard, and experimentation roadmap needed to identify bottlenecks, prioritize opportunities, and forecast veterinarian growth by channel and market.
  • Use data and unit economics to allocate investment toward the highest-return opportunities and build the systems, capabilities, and team required to scale.
  • Lead the IndeVets Brand
  • Own IndeVets' brand strategy, positioning, messaging, and creative across veterinarians and veterinary hospitals.
  • Build a distinctive and trusted brand that makes IndeVets one of the most compelling career options for veterinarians and a differentiated partner for hospitals.
  • Drive Hospital Marketing
  • Partner with Sales to build scalable demand-generation programs that create qualified hospital opportunities and support geographic expansion.
  • Improve segmentation, targeting, messaging, and sales enablement to increase Marketing's contribution to pipeline and revenue while keeping hospital demand aligned with veterinarian supply.
